Best 92086 California Public Elementary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public elementary school serving 101 students in 92086, CA.
The top-ranked public elementary school in 92086, CA is Warner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public elementary school in zipcode 92086 have an average math proficiency score of 22% (versus the California public elementary school average of 36%), and reading proficiency score of 32% (versus the 45% statewide average). Elementary schools in 92086, CA have an average ranking of 3/10, which is in the bottom 50% of California public elementary schools.
Minority enrollment is 81% of the student body (majority American Indian), which is more than the California public elementary school average of 79% (majority Hispanic).
